Who needs study of restorative justice?
01
There are various individuals, organizations, and communities that can benefit from the study of restorative justice. These include:
02
- Academics and researchers in the field of criminology and criminal justice who aim to expand knowledge and understanding of restorative justice practices.
03
- Law enforcement agencies and criminal justice professionals who want to explore alternative approaches to traditional punitive justice systems.
04
- Advocacy groups and non-profit organizations that focus on criminal justice reform and promoting restorative justice practices.
05
- Legal professionals and policymakers who are involved in shaping and implementing criminal justice policies and practices.
06
- Offenders and victims of crime who seek alternatives to traditional punitive measures and want to participate in the healing and reconciliation process.
07
- Communities affected by crime who aim to address the root causes of offenses, restore relationships, and promote community healing.
08
- Educational institutions offering courses or programs in criminal justice, criminology, or related fields, where the study of restorative justice can provide valuable knowledge and insights to students.
09
In summary, the study of restorative justice is relevant and beneficial to a wide range of individuals and organizations involved in the criminal justice system and related fields. It offers alternative approaches to traditional punitive justice and seeks to promote healing, reconciliation, and community well-being.
